Do Stretch Marks Go Away After Weight Loss. They do not go away when you lose weight. Stretch marks are caused by damaged collagen, but losing weight can't repair damaged collagen, so the scars don't disappear when you shed pounds.

Dietary fat reduction
Reducing the amount of dietary fat you consume is an effective strategy for weight loss. It can aid in slowing the process of digestion, which makes you feel fuller longer. Consuming heart-healthy foods, such as those in fish as well as olive oil and avocado, is also helpful. Trans fats on the contrary, can raise your calorie intake. This kind of fat is often found in processed snack foods as well as baked products.
There are only a handful of long-term interventions studies that have targeted diet fat reduction for weight loss. Actually, a few studies have shown positive results through reducing dietary fats to as little around 15% the calories. In these studies, the Women's Health Trial reported that participants lost an average of 3.2 kg over 2 years despite eating in a diet with about 50% less fat.

Self-monitoring
Self-monitoring is the key element for achieving weight loss. It assists in keeping accurate track of calories eaten. The more frequently you track your intake, the more accurate your data will become. It is equally important to understand the number of calories you're taking in on a daily basis.
A randomized trial involving 80 obese males aged between 40 to 69 was conducted to study the effect of self-monitoring on weight loss. Participants were asked to keep one-day food journals and then rate their intake of food using a weekly scale of rating. The results showed that 45.6 percent of participants were regular in the self-monitoring they performed and that the majority of them were monitoring their food intake on at minimum 75% of the days. Only 10.5 percent reported their food intake for less than 25 percent of the time.
